running the Moroso here too for now until the SuperVic gets here but with the universal Griffin radiator I had to customize the Moroso where it bends on the bottom due to the radiator inlet outlet being swapped from stock, otherwise everything works fine, you might just have work with moving the radiator to the passenger side to help clear everything if it's a "direct-fit" type. Hard to tell without pics what all isn't fitting.
